📈 Chart Patterns: KFINTECH is consolidating with weak momentum, trading below both 50 DMA and 200 DMA, showing medium-term bearish bias.
📊 Moving Averages: Price below 50 DMA (954 ₹) and 200 DMA (1,024 ₹), confirming short and medium-term weakness.
📉 RSI: At 41.2, RSI suggests bearish momentum with potential oversold conditions.
📈 MACD: Positive at 5.08, signaling mild bullish attempts but lacking strong conviction.
📊 Bollinger Bands: Price near lower band, reflecting weakness but potential for short-term rebound.
📉 Volume Trends: Current volume (71.2L) significantly above weekly average (22.8L), showing strong participation despite price weakness.
🔑 Short-Term Momentum Signals: Weak bullish attempts from MACD, but RSI and moving averages suggest consolidation with bearish undertone.
🎯 Entry Zone: 880–900 ₹ near support levels.
🎯 Exit Zone: 950–970 ₹ near resistance cluster and 50 DMA.
📌 Trend Status: Consolidating with bearish bias.
